> from my bootup: 
> --- 
> Probing for PnP devices: 
> CSN 1 Vendor ID: CTL00c5 [0xc5008c0e] Serial 0x0d6d8df3 Comp ID: PNPb02f [0x2fb0d041] 
> CSN 2 Vendor ID: ASU1688 [0x88167506] Serial 0x00000044 Comp ID: @@@0000 [0x00000000] 
> CSN 2 (Dynalink IS64PH) is disabled. 
> --- 

Your bios disabled it. Take a look at "man pnp" on how to enable it.
